About Kiel, Guide and Tourist Attractions
(Kiel, Schleswig Holstein, Germany)




Located in the north of Germany, Kiel is an important passenger port and also an excellent tourist destination, especially for those with an affinity for shopping.

Although bombed heavily at the end of the war, Kiel still retains some historical treasures and also boasts Germany's biggest indoor shopping centre.




About Kiel: What to do in Kiel - Kiel, Schleswig Holstein, Germany
Perhaps the most popular pastime in Kiel is sailing; the harbour is huge and there are lakes all around the city. The waters are open to professional and amateur sailors alike and the attractive coastline is a big hit with day cruisers. If you are here in June, don't miss the Kieler Woche, one of the world's biggest sailing events that attracts sailors from all four corners of the globe.

Also in the region and right on the border with Denmark is the town of Flensburg, with its unbeatable waterfront setting and profusion of cafés and restaurants. The city centre offers much more in the way of medieval architecture and historical ambience than Kiel and a regular boat ride will take in some of Germany's most spectacular scenery.

About Kiel: Tourist Attractions - Kiel, Schleswig Holstein, Germany
Apart from the waterfront, Kiel also boasts numerous other quality tourist attractions and tourist areas. As would be expected in such an important maritime city, Kiel excels in its offering of water-theme museums. The Maritime Museum is very popular with visitors. The Oceanography Institute Aquarium and the Warleberger Hof City Museum are also immensely popular. For art lovers, it is worth visiting the Stadtgalerie as it has regular art exhibitions.

The tourist information office is not far from the main Kiel railway station in the city centre and you can learn all about the local ferries on the Kieler Förde. Many Scandinavians also come to Kiel for the shopping and the huge Sophienhof superstore, just up the road from the tourist information centre, has numerous quality outlets. Night time revellers might like to try Alter Markt square, with its many bars and pubs. Another popular night time venue is the Ostseehalle, which holds concerts year-round.
